What is Intelligent Speed Assistance (ISA)?
Intelligent Speed Assistance is a vehicle safety system that keeps a car at or below the legal speed limit by reading the road’s posted limit and managing the engine in real time.
The technology pairs GPS positioning with digitally mapped speed-limit data, and in many systems a forward-facing camera that recognizes speed-limit signs. The vehicle always knows the limit for the exact stretch of road it is on, and it acts on that knowledge instead of trusting the driver to behave.
There are two broad flavors of this technology, and the difference matters a lot. The first is passive ISA, sometimes called advisory or “open” ISA, which only warns you with a beep or a flashing icon when you cross the limit.
The second is active ISA, which actually steps in and prevents the car from going faster. Every US state program so far uses the active form, because a warning that a reckless driver can ignore is not much of a countermeasure. Active ISA changes the equation from a polite suggestion into governed mobility.
How does an ISA device limit a vehicle’s speed?
An active ISA device limits speed by connecting to the vehicle’s accelerator and engine control unit, then reducing throttle input once the car reaches the posted limit. It does not slam on the brakes.
Instead, it gently chokes off the fuel and air the engine needs to accelerate further, so the car eases up smoothly rather than lurching. If you press the gas to the floor in a speed-capped vehicle, the pedal simply stops responding past the limit. As one device maker demonstrated during a test drive, you can floor it and the car just will not go faster.
The system leans on three data sources working together: GPS location, a digital map of speed limits, and in newer units a camera that reads roadside signs. This layered approach handles the messy reality of American roads, where limits change block by block. Most programs also build in a safety valve.
Washington State’s design, for example, lets a driver override the cap up to three times a month for situations like passing a slower vehicle, after which the limiter snaps back on. That override exists because a car that cannot briefly speed up to merge or pass can create its own hazard through speed differential.
Active ISA vs. passive (advisory) ISA
The split between active and passive ISA comes down to one question: does the technology inform the driver or control the car? Here is the practical contrast.
| Feature | Passive (Advisory) ISA | Active ISA |
|---|---|---|
| What it does | Warns with sound or visual alert | Physically prevents exceeding the limit |
| Driver can ignore it | Yes | No |
| Used in US state programs | No | Yes |
| Typical setting | Optional feature on some new cars | Court-ordered for reckless drivers |
| Override option | Not needed | Limited, controlled exceptions |
Passive systems already exist quietly in plenty of new vehicles as a driver-assist convenience. Active systems are the ones reshaping law, because they target behavior that a warning chime was never going to fix.
Which US states have Intelligent Speed Assistance programs?
As of 2026, three US jurisdictions have enacted ISA laws: Washington, D.C., Virginia, and Washington State, with several more states pushing bills through their legislatures.
This is a brand-new policy area, so the map is changing almost every legislative session. The momentum has been driven heavily by advocacy groups like Families for Safe Streets, made up of people who lost loved ones to speeding crashes. Here is where each program stands.
Washington, D.C. — the STEER Act
Washington, D.C. became the first jurisdiction in the country to pass ISA legislation, doing so in 2024, with the law taking effect in October 2024. Known as the STEER Act, it requires ISA device installation for drivers whose licenses were suspended or revoked because of excessive speeding or reckless driving.
The District set a tiered structure: roughly a one-year program for a first qualifying conviction, scaling up to as long as four years for a fourth offense. The vote in D.C. was unanimous, which tells you how rare the bipartisan agreement on this issue has become.
Virginia — the first US state ISA Program
Virginia holds the title of first US state to enact an ISA law, signed by Governor Glenn Youngkin and set to take effect in July 2026. The Virginia program gives judges the discretion, not a blanket mandate, to order an ISA device for drivers convicted of extreme reckless driving, specifically those caught exceeding 100 miles per hour.
Enrollment also reaches drivers convicted four times of racing or exhibition driving, with a five-year device term, and drivers who rack up 18 demerit points within 12 months, with a nine-month term.
The teeth of the law sit in its anti-tampering rule: disabling or bypassing the device is a Class 1 misdemeanor punishable by up to 12 months in jail and a $2,500 fine. The Virginia Alcohol Safety Action Program, already experienced with ignition interlocks, is set to administer it.
The design is clever because it hands courts a middle path. Instead of choosing between a full license suspension and letting a dangerous driver roam free, a judge can grant governed mobility. The driver keeps access to work, school, and medical appointments, but the car physically cannot speed.
Washington State — Engrossed Substitute House Bill 1596
Washington State became the third jurisdiction to pass ISA legislation, with its House approving the bill 84 to 12. The law targets people with a history of excessive speeding, which it defines precisely: 20 miles per hour or more over the limit where the limit is above 40 mph, or 10 mph or more over where the limit is 40 mph or below.
Drivers who have their license suspended must use the device for 120 to 150 days. Participants cover their own costs, including a monthly fee reported around $21, with a portion funding device access for low-income drivers.
The program is scheduled to take effect in 2029, giving the state’s Department of Licensing time to build the framework. (Effective dates in newly passed laws sometimes shift, so the final enacted date is worth confirming against the signed bill text.)
Georgia — passed the legislature, then vetoed
Georgia came close but did not cross the finish line. The Georgia legislature passed an ISA-style speed-limiter bill, but Governor Brian Kemp vetoed it in 2025.
The measure would have let judges require speed-limiting technology in the vehicles of drivers whose licenses were suspended for egregious violations like street racing. Its bipartisan support showed the political appetite is real, even when a single executive signature can stall it.
States with pending ISA legislation

Beyond the three that crossed the line, a cluster of states keeps the bills alive. New York, California, Maryland, and Arizona have all advanced ISA legislation, though several need additional sessions to pass. New York is where the very first US ISA-related bill was introduced, planting the seed for everything that followed.
California’s governor previously vetoed a broader mandate, and the state’s assembly has since moved toward a more targeted “Stop Super Speeders” approach modeled on Virginia and Washington. Expect this list to keep growing.
How US state ISA programs compare
The fastest way to see the patchwork is to line the programs up side by side. Each state agrees on the core idea, using ISA as a substitute for license suspension, but they disagree on who qualifies and for how long.
| Jurisdiction | Status | Effective | Who Must Enroll | Program Length | Tampering Penalty |
|---|---|---|---|---|---|
| Washington, D.C. | Enacted (first) | Sept 2025 | Suspended/revoked for excessive speeding | ~1 yr first to 4 yrs fourth | Penalized under the act |
| Virginia | Enacted (first state) | July 2026 | 100+ mph reckless; 4× racing; 18 points/12 mo | 9 months to 5 years | Class 1 misdemeanor, up to 12 mo + $2,500 |
| Washington State | Enacted | 2029 | “Excessive speeding” thresholds | 120–150 days | Misdemeanor to tamper |
| Georgia | Vetoed | — | Suspended for racing/egregious offenses | Proposed | Proposed |
| NY, CA, MD, AZ | Pending | — | Reckless / repeat offenders (varies) | Varies | Varies |
There is no national standard yet, which is exactly why the American Association of Motor Vehicle Administrators formed an ISA Working Group, aiming to build reciprocity between states from the start rather than repeating the tangled, inconsistent rules that grew up around ignition interlocks.
Who is required to install an ISA device in the US?
The people facing an ISA mandate are mostly “super speeders” and repeat reckless drivers, ordered to install the device as an alternative to losing their license entirely.
This narrow focus is deliberate. Super speeders make up a small slice of all drivers, yet they cause a wildly disproportionate share of fatal crashes, so targeting them delivers a big safety return without touching ordinary motorists.
The policy logic gets sharper when you look at one stubborn statistic. According to data cited by NHTSA and motor vehicle administrators, around 75% of drivers with a suspended license keep driving anyway. A suspension on paper does little if the person ignores it and gets behind the wheel.
An ISA device flips that script: the driver may still drive, but the vehicle itself enforces the speed limit. Justice-reform advocates have warmed to the approach too, because it reduces tense roadside stops between motorists and armed officers, swapping enforcement after the fact for prevention built into the car.
What is the federal outlook for Intelligent Speed Assistance?
At the federal level, there is no nationwide ISA mandate for passenger vehicles as of 2026, and the action remains a mix of recommendations, studies, and a few reversals. Washington has been far more cautious than the states, and recent federal moves have actually pulled back from speed-limiter requirements rather than expanding them.
NTSB recommendations on ISA
The National Transportation Safety Board has been the loudest federal voice for this technology. After a 2022 crash in which a driver going 103 mph killed nine people, the NTSB called for industry-wide adoption of speed-limiting technology and urged NHTSA to incentivize ISA in new vehicles.
NTSB Chair Jennifer Homendy framed the issue bluntly, arguing that the country knows how to save these lives but lacks the collective will to act. The catch is that the NTSB only recommends; it cannot write binding rules.
NHTSA’s position and the New Car Assessment Program
The National Highway Traffic Safety Administration, which does have rulemaking power, responded to the NTSB in April 2024 and has explored ISA pathways, including the idea of an ISA interlock aimed at the worst repeat speeders.
Progress is slow, partly because of long-standing practical hurdles the agency has flagged for years: speed-limit maps in the US are not always current, owners do not reliably update them, and sign-reading cameras still need to be dependable across every road type. These data-quality questions keep a broad federal mandate stuck in the study phase.
Withdrawal of the federal heavy-truck speed limiter rule
A separate and often-confused thread involves big trucks, and here the federal government moved in the opposite direction. FMCSA and NHTSA formally withdrew the long-pending proposal to require speed limiters on heavy trucks over 26,000 pounds, effective 27 June 2025.
That proposal traced back to a 2016 rulemaking and a 2022 follow-up, and it drew tens of thousands of comments from carriers, drivers, and safety groups. The agencies cited unresolved data gaps about costs and benefits, especially the safety risk of speed differentials between governed trucks and faster passenger traffic. The withdrawal preserves the status quo: no federal speed-limiter mandate for commercial trucks.
The DRIVE Act and “Pathways to Safer Streets”
Federal politics keeps tugging in two directions. On one side, lawmakers introduced the DRIVE Act to bar federal agencies from imposing speed-limiter regulations at all.
On the other, the Department of Transportation’s “Pathways to Safer Streets” initiative, announced in April 2026, referenced intelligent speed-assist strategies as part of its safety toolkit. The net result is a federal landscape that talks about ISA, studies ISA, but leaves the actual mandates to the states for now.
How does US ISA policy compare to the European Union?
The contrast with Europe is stark. The European Union already requires ISA on all new cars, while the US relies on targeted, offender-based state programs.
Under the EU’s General Safety Regulation, ISA became mandatory for all new vehicle types from July 2022 and for every new car sold from July 2024. European systems work much like cruise control, limiting engine power to hold the posted speed rather than braking, and they come with an on/off switch to ease public acceptance, though the default status is “on” every time the car starts.
So Europe took the universal route, baking ISA into the entire fleet by law. America took the surgical route, aiming the technology only at the drivers who have already proven dangerous. Both paths chase the same goal of fewer speed-related deaths, but they reflect very different ideas about regulation, privacy, and personal mobility in a car-dependent culture.
ISA and speed limiters for commercial fleets and public vehicles in the US
While lawmakers debate consumer mandates, US fleets have already embraced speed-limiting technology voluntarily, far ahead of any legal requirement.
Benchmarking data from the National Private Truck Council shows that roughly 86% of private fleets already run speed limiters, set at speeds the carriers choose for safety and fuel efficiency. The technology is not experimental in commercial settings; it is standard practice.
Public fleets tell the same story. New York City began piloting electronically speed-limited vehicles in 2022 and has since expanded active ISA to more than 7,000 city vehicles, proving the approach scales. School buses are another natural fit, where a hard speed cap protects the most precious cargo on the road.
For operators, the appeal is simple math: lower top speeds mean less kinetic energy in a crash, fewer at-fault incidents, smoother insurance conversations, and better fuel economy from reduced hard acceleration. Fleet telematics ties it all together, letting managers see speed data alongside location and driver behavior.
